Output ec26dcc42fb40778396b53ffdb3dea72a10941401b0f49f86893c21ce9be4da8:1

value
350078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d6b0a55cfd376291d16e7cbbe7c8f5981c446e5 OP_EQUAL
address
34NZkQHTE86xHeBV3dMMGyQaLncYNTZBKg
transaction
ec26dcc42fb40778396b53ffdb3dea72a10941401b0f49f86893c21ce9be4da8